Technological Advances Impacting PVC Durability

By 2025, sourcing corrosion-resistant PVC will incur huge challenges in supply chain management for global industry-moving towards sustainability. PVC is forecasted to be under a lot of demand, as its applications are unique in construction and agricultural chemicals, and it will eventually lead to existing supply chains being under great duress. Companies will face volatility in the prices and availability of raw materials, mainly ethylene dichloride, used in the manufacture of PVC.

Besides that, the functional coil coatings sector is likely to emerge in the near future, which will call for modern changes in what concerns the sustainability and efficiency of PVC products. They might find it quite difficult sourcing, as changes would deal with having suppliers who are not just up to the required quality standards but also have their end footprint in sustainable practices. Connecting and integrating all actors of the supply chain would absolve most of these issues and ensure that there is a steady flow of corrosion-resistant materials in the rising economy.
